Microsoft’sXbox Game Passsubscription service gets new games every month, but Microsoft doesn’t like to announce them too far in advance. Instead, Microsoft likes to keep the focus on the newXbox Game Passgames that are coming in the near future, usually announcing them in two week batches. The same is likely to be true for the new Xbox Game Pass games for June 2022, meaning fans shouldn’t expect to learn more about the lineup until around June 1.

Assassin’s Creed Originsis generally considered one of the better gamesin theAssassin’s Creedfranchise, going by review scores. It gives players the chance to explore an open world Egypt, boasting impressive graphics while taking the series' overarching narrative in new directions. It’s the precursor to popularAssassin’s Creedgames likeAssassin’s Creed OdysseyandAssassin’s Creed Valhalla, so it’s well worth a look by those who have yet to play it.
It should be noted that Microsoft itself hasn’t confirmed the Xbox Game Pass dates forFor Honor: Marching Fire EditionorAssassin’s Creed Origins. However, the officialXbox Game Pass appon Xbox consoles let the cat out of the bag early, giving fans an early notice about when they can expect to see the games added to the lineup.

The first two weeks of the new Xbox Game Pass games for June 2022 are mystery beyondFor Honor: Marching Fire EditionandAssassin’s Creed Origins, but fans know of two games coming in the latter half of the month. On June 21,Shadowrun Trilogywill be added to Xbox Game Pass.Shadowrun TrilogyfeaturesShadowrun Returns,Shadowrun Dragonfall - Director’s Cut, andShadowrun Hong Kong - Extended Editionall in one package. While these games have previously been available to purchase on other platforms, this marksShadowrun Trilogy’s debut on Xbox consoles, and so it could be considered a day one game.
